📘 GE Fanuc VMIVME-1128 Digital Input Board
Comprehensive Datasheet & Technical Overview
The GE Fanuc VMIVME-1128 Digital Input Board is an advanced VMEbus-compatible module designed for industrial automation and control systems. With its robust design, high input density, and reliable signal handling, it is widely used in mission-critical environments requiring secure and precise digital input acquisition.
📑 Product Datasheet (Technical Specifications)
Parameter | Description |
---|---|
Manufacturer | GE Fanuc Automation |
Model | VMIVME-1128 |
Product Type | Digital Input Board |
Origin | USA |
Bus Standard | VMEbus (ANSI/IEEE 1014-1987 compliant) |
Input Channels | 32 optically isolated digital input channels |
Input Voltage Range | 0 – 30 VDC |
Input Current | 2 – 10 mA (depending on configuration) |
Isolation | 1500 V RMS isolation between input and logic circuits |
Response Time | ≤ 5 ms (typical) |
Board Dimensions | 233.4 mm x 160 mm (Standard 6U Eurocard VME format) |
Weight | Approx. 450 g |
Operating Power | +5 VDC @ 500 mA (typical), minimal power dissipation |
Connector Type | DIN 41612 connector, 96-pin |
Color / Finish | Green PCB with industrial-grade coating |
Mounting | Rack-mounted in VME chassis, screw-fixed installation |
Environmental Rating | Operating temperature: 0°C to +70°C, Storage: -40°C to +85°C |
Humidity | 5% – 95% non-condensing |
Shock & Vibration | Designed for rugged industrial environments |
Protection | Opto-isolation, over-voltage protection, reverse polarity safeguard |
Waterproof Rating | Not waterproof; requires installation in sealed industrial enclosures |
Certifications | CE, UL compliant |

⚙️ Installation Requirements
- Ensure the board is installed in a VMEbus-compatible rack chassis with adequate grounding.
- Secure the board with mounting screws to avoid vibration-related disconnections.
- Maintain ambient operating temperatures between 0°C and +70°C.
- Use shielded cables for digital input wiring to minimize EMI interference.
- Install in a sealed control cabinet if environmental exposure to dust or moisture is expected.
🛠️ Maintenance Details
- Perform visual inspection during scheduled downtime for dust or connector corrosion.
- Clean the PCB using anti-static brushes and IPA wipes if necessary.
- Verify input channel integrity periodically through system diagnostic tests.
- Ensure all cables remain firmly attached and free from mechanical stress.
- Replace in case of severe component failure; board-level repair requires qualified service.
